Sir F. Chook, Inventor of Leopard Oil

Likeness captured upon a daguerrotype machine in Japan, July 1891


Wherein the Author reflects upon certain topical & personal issues of the Day.

The archive for July, 2011

The following lettres were posted during this month:

Bucking & Cump, Picture Publishers

Posted upon the 30th of July, 2011

It has long been academic consensus that sex was invented in 1972 by Mrs Deirdre Sex, a fitter-and-joiner’s wife from Clapton-on-Sea, Rutland. The recent discovery of an extant product catalogue dated to 1924, detailing publications depicting certain acts previously thought unknown in the inter-war period, has challenged this belief and created a rift in contemporary […]